Cassius Coolidge illustrated at least two books, The Independence Day Horror at Killsbury and Prophet of Peace. Both were written by his first cousin Asenath Coolidge. They were published in 1905 and 1907, respectively. Therefore, they are in the public domain, and am I allowed to post the illustrations from them. (If this is not the case, please let me know.)
